7-Day Educational Itinerary in Bangalore

Sunday, October 29: Bangalore Palace

Start your trip by exploring the magnificent Bangalore Palace in the morning. This architectural marvel is reminiscent of the British era and offers a glimpse into the city's history. In the afternoon, visit the nearby Jawaharlal Nehru Planetarium for an educational and immersive experience about space and astronomy. End the day with a visit to Cubbon Park, a lush green oasis in the heart of the city.

  • Bangalore Palace: INR 230 (estimated cost), 3 hours (estimated time spent)
  • Jawaharlal Nehru Planetarium: INR 50 (estimated cost), 2 hours (estimated time spent)
  • Cubbon Park: Free, 2 hours (estimated time spent)
Monday, October 30: Visvesvaraya Industrial & Technological Museum

Explore the Visvesvaraya Industrial & Technological Museum dedicated to science and technology. Spend the morning learning about various scientific principles through interactive exhibits. In the afternoon, visit Lalbagh Botanical Garden, known for its diverse plant species and beautiful landscapes. Wrap up the day by indulging in some shopping at Commercial Street.

  • Visvesvaraya Industrial & Technological Museum: INR 40 (estimated cost), 3 hours (estimated time spent)
  • Lalbagh Botanical Garden: INR 20 (estimated cost), 2 hours (estimated time spent)
  • Commercial Street: Cost varies, 2 hours (estimated time spent)
Tuesday, October 31: National Gallery of Modern Art

Start your day with a visit to the National Gallery of Modern Art, showcasing contemporary and modern artwork by Indian artists. Spend the morning exploring the diverse art collections. In the afternoon, head to the Government Museum, home to a wide range of artifacts, including archaeological finds and historical relics. Wrap up the day by enjoying the vibrant atmosphere of Brigade Road.

  • National Gallery of Modern Art: INR 20 (estimated cost), 3 hours (estimated time spent)
  • Government Museum: INR 50 (estimated cost), 2 hours (estimated time spent)
  • Brigade Road: Cost varies, 2 hours (estimated time spent)
Wednesday, November 1: Indian Institute of Science

Immerse yourself in the world of scientific research at the prestigious Indian Institute of Science. Spend the morning exploring the various departments and innovative projects. In the afternoon, visit the Jawaharlal Nehru Centre for Advanced Scientific Research, promoting cutting-edge scientific research. Wind down the day by taking a relaxing stroll at the beautiful Ulsoor Lake.

  • Indian Institute of Science: Free, 3 hours (estimated time spent)
  • Jawaharlal Nehru Centre for Advanced Scientific Research: Free, 2 hours (estimated time spent)
  • Ulsoor Lake: Free, 1 hour (estimated time spent)
Thursday, November 2: Bangalore Museum

Start your day by visiting the Bangalore Museum, showcasing the rich cultural heritage of the region. Explore the various galleries and exhibits that display artifacts, paintings, and sculptures. In the afternoon, head to the innovative and interactive HAL Aerospace Museum, offering insights into India's aviation history. End the day with a visit to the Bull Temple, dedicated to the sacred bull Nandi.

  • Bangalore Museum: INR 20 (estimated cost), 3 hours (estimated time spent)
  • HAL Aerospace Museum: INR 50 (estimated cost), 2 hours (estimated time spent)
  • Bull Temple: Free, 1 hour (estimated time spent)
Friday, November 3: Indian Institute of Astrophysics

Embark on a journey of stargazing and astrophysics at the Indian Institute of Astrophysics. Spend the morning learning about astronomical phenomena and observing celestial objects through telescopes. In the afternoon, visit the Indira Gandhi Musical Fountain Park for a mesmerizing fountain show. End the day by exploring the vibrant markets of Malleswaram.

  • Indian Institute of Astrophysics: Free, 3 hours (estimated time spent)
  • Indira Gandhi Musical Fountain Park: INR 30 (estimated cost), 1 hour (estimated time spent)
  • Malleswaram Market: Cost varies, 2 hours (estimated time spent)
Saturday, November 4: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O)

Wrap up your educational trip with a visit to the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O). Discover India's advancements in space technology and learn about the country's space missions. Spend the morning exploring the exhibits and interactive displays. In the afternoon, take a leisurely walk at the serene Lalbagh Botanical Garden, filled with colorful flora and fauna.

  •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O): Free, 3 hours (estimated time spent)
  • Lalbagh Botanical Garden: INR 20 (estimated cost), 2 hours (estimated time spent)

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, consider visiting the Indian Music Experience, an interactive museum dedicated to Indian music. Another local favorite is the Karnataka Chitrakala Parishath, an art complex showcasing traditional and contemporary artworks. These hidden gems offer unique insights into the cultural heritage of Bangalore.
